Liquid chlorophyll is a concentrated form of chlorophyll—the green pigment found in plants that plays a vital role in photosynthesis. Extracted primarily from sources like mulberry leaves or alfalfa, chlorophyll in liquid form is easier for the human body to absorb, offering a potent dose of nutrients in just a few drops.

Incorporating liquid chlorophyll into your routine is simple. The standard dosage typically ranges from 50 to 100 mg per day, depending on the product and individual health goals. Always follow the recommended dosage on the label or consult a healthcare provider.
Chlorophyll liquid can be mixed into water, juice, or smoothies—many users prefer it in cold water for a refreshing green tonic. It’s best taken in the morning or early afternoon to maximize its energizing effects.
For the best liquid chlorophyll experience, look for supplements free from artificial additives and derived from high-quality plant sources like mulberry or alfalfa. Organic or third-party tested brands often provide the highest quality assurance.

While liquid chlorophyll is generally safe for most people, some may experience mild side effects such as digestive discomfort, diarrhea, or green-tinted stools. These symptoms are typically short-lived and decrease as the body adjusts.
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should consult a healthcare provider before using chlorophyll liquid. Likewise, if you’re taking medications or have underlying health conditions, it’s best to seek medical guidance before starting supplementation.
